Verse 22
{ "verseID": "Jeremiah.18.22", "source": "תִּשָּׁמַ֤ע זְעָקָה֙ מִבָּ֣תֵּיהֶ֔ם כִּֽי־תָבִ֧יא עֲלֵיהֶ֛ם גְּד֖וּד פִּתְאֹ֑ם כִּֽי־כָר֤וּ *שיחה **שׁוּחָה֙ לְלָכְדֵ֔נִי וּפַחִ֖ים טָמְנ֥וּ לְרַגְלָֽי׃", "text": "*Tiššāmaʿ* *zĕʿāqāh* from their houses when you *tābîʾ* upon them *gĕdûd* *pitʾōm*, for they *kārû* *šûḥāh* to *lĕlākdēnî*, and *paḥîm* they *ṭāmĕnû* for my feet", "grammar": { "*Tiššāmaʿ*": "verb, niphal imperfect, 3rd person feminine singular - let it be heard/will be heard", "*zĕʿāqāh*": "noun, feminine singular - outcry/cry", "*tābîʾ*": "verb, hiphil imperfect, 2nd person masculine singular - you bring", "*gĕdûd*": "noun, masculine singular - troop/band/raiding party", "*pitʾōm*": "adverb - suddenly", "*kārû*": "verb, qal perfect, 3rd person common plural - they dug", "*šûḥāh*": "noun, feminine singular - pit/trap", "*lĕlākdēnî*": "preposition + qal infinitive construct with 1st person singular suffix - to capture me", "*paḥîm*": "noun, masculine plural - snares/traps", "*ṭāmĕnû*": "verb, qal perfect, 3rd person common plural - they hid/concealed" }, "variants": { "*Tiššāmaʿ*": "let it be heard/will be heard", "*zĕʿāqāh*": "outcry/cry/scream", "*tābîʾ*": "you bring/cause to come", "*gĕdûd*": "troop/band/raiding party", "*pitʾōm*": "suddenly/unexpectedly", "*kārû*": "they dug/excavated", "*šûḥāh*": "pit/trap/snare", "*lĕlākdēnî*": "to capture me/catch me", "*paḥîm*": "snares/traps/nets", "*ṭāmĕnû*": "they hid/concealed/set" } }
